c语言读写xls文件(c语言以什么为单位读写文件)

介绍

C语言是一种广泛应用于系统软件和应用软件的编程语言,在许多领域都有着广泛的应用。而与Excel表格文件的读写相关的操作,在C语言中同样可以实现。本文将介绍如何使用C语言读写.xls文件。

读取Excel文件

要在C语言中读取Excel文件,首先需要引入相关的库文件,比如libxls。这个库提供了读取.xls文件的函数和结构体,可以方便地读取Excel文件中的数据。读取一个.xls文件的过程可以简单分为以下几步:

  1. 打开Excel文件,使用libxls提供的函数打开一个.xls文件。
  2. 读取Excel文件中的工作表,使用libxls提供的函数获取工作表的数量和每个工作表的名称。
  3. 对于每个工作表,可以通过libxls提供的函数读取每个单元格中的数据。
  4. 关闭Excel文件,使用libxls提供的函数关闭打开的.xls文件。

通过以上步骤,我们就可以在C语言中读取.xls文件中的数据了。

写入Excel文件

除了读取.xls文件,C语言也可以很方便地写入.xls文件。同样需要引入相关的库文件,比如libxls,并按照以下步骤进行写入操作:

  1. 创建一个Excel文件,使用libxls提供的函数创建一个.xls文件。
  2. 在Excel文件中创建一个工作表,使用libxls提供的函数在.xls文件中创建一个工作表。
  3. 将数据写入工作表中的单元格,使用libxls提供的函数将数据写入.xls文件中的工作表。
  4. 保存并关闭Excel文件,使用libxls提供的函数保存并关闭.xls文件。

通过以上步骤,我们就可以在C语言中写入.xls文件了。

总结

通过使用C语言中的相关库函数,我们可以在C语言中实现对.xls文件的读写操作。在进行读取操作时,需要打开Excel文件、获取工作表和读取单元格的数据;而在进行写入操作时,需要创建Excel文件、创建工作表和将数据写入单元格。这些操作都可以通过引入相关库文件,并调用相应函数来实现。希望本文对于读取和写入.xls文件的C语言编程有所帮助。

本文来自投稿,不代表亲测学习网立场,如若转载,请注明出处:https://www.qince.net/cyuyan5q.html

郑重声明:

本站所有内容均由互联网收集整理、网友上传,并且以计算机技术研究交流为目的,仅供大家参考、学习,不存在任何商业目的与商业用途。 若您需要商业运营或用于其他商业活动,请您购买正版授权并合法使用。

我们不承担任何技术及版权问题,且不对任何资源负法律责任。

如遇到资源无法下载,请点击这里失效报错。失效报错提交后记得查看你的留言信息,24小时之内反馈信息。

如有侵犯您的版权,请给我们私信,我们会尽快处理,并诚恳的向你道歉!

(0)
上一篇 2023年7月31日 下午8:13
下一篇 2023年7月31日 下午8:14

猜你喜欢